Have you tried the mem-infra category <https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/master/docs/memory-infra/> in chrome tracing? That should give you at least some of the items you are looking for if you select the "v8" item in a mem-infra trace event. Cheers, Ross On Thu, 18 Apr 2019 at 20:46, Pierre Langlois <[email protected]> wrote: > Hello! > > Lately I've been looking at V8's heap consumption and tooling around > measuring and tracking it. I see we have a few different ways to do it > and I've been thinking about adding a new one :-). So I thought I'd ask > what you thought first. > > Essentially, I want to collect stats about the heap regularly, at > every GC for instance, and then either plot this information over > time, or do some statistics like getting the peak for each space, or > figuring out how fragmented we are, ...etc > > So at the moment, to do things like that we can: > > * Use the V8 API or the inspector protocol. > > * Use --trace-gc-verbose to print statistics at every GC. > > * Use --trace-gc-object-stats or --enable-tracing with the > "v8.gc_stats" category enabled to collect object statistics at every > mark-compact GC. > > * ... something I missed? > > I started using --trace-gc-verbose and it works OK but its output is > not very friendly for tools to consume. And on the other hand, I like > how the TRACE macros work and are used with --trace-gc-object-stats. > > So I've been thinking about adding a new trace event that prints heap > statistics, enabled with the existing `v8.gc_stats` tracing category. I > haven't thought about all the details yet, but the current idea is the > following: > > - Add a "instant" trace event for the "v8.gc_stats" category for > every GC, both the scavenger and mark-compact, as opposed to > --trace-gc-object-stats which triggers only using mark-compact. > > - The event could be called "V8.GC_Heap_Stats", to mirror > "V8.GC_Object_Stats". > > - Output JSON with both global and per-space statstics, just like > GetHeapStatistics() and GetHeapSpaceStatistics() from the V8 API do. > > How does this sound? Are there tools (tools/heap-stats?) that would > benefit from this?
